如何识别触发Download_Complete意图的文件

时间:2011-07-15 21:04:15

标签: android broadcastreceiver download-manager identify

我正在开发一个应用程序,它将下载另一个apk文件,并要求安装。

由于我的目标是GingerBread,我正在使用DownloadManager类。

无论如何知道哪个下载文件触发了DOWNLOAD_COMPLETE意图?

1 个答案:

答案 0 :(得分:4)

它存储在EXTRA_DOWNLOAD_ID:

public static final String EXTRA_DOWNLOAD_ID

自:API等级9

Intent额外包含在ACTION_DOWNLOAD_COMPLETE意图中,表示刚刚完成的下载ID(作为长整数)。

常数值:“extra_download_id”

http://developer.android.com/reference/android/app/DownloadManager.html#ACTION_DOWNLOAD_COMPLETE